Kelsea Ballerini Reveals Her Creative Fitness Tricks

by Lana Green

Kelsea Ballerini lives a healthy lifestyle without stress or complications. The singer of “Cowboys Cry Too” explained how she stays well both on and off the road.

“It depends on what I’m doing,” Kelsea told E! News in an exclusive interview. She recently finished her latest tour in April. “When I was touring, I stuck to a strict routine. Sleep was my top priority. Everything else came after that. If I didn’t get enough sleep, I couldn’t function the next day.”

Kelsea developed easy habits that help her maintain balance. “I wasn’t too hard on my body because I was active every night, performing on stage for 90 minutes,” the 31-year-old said. She is also the newest brand ambassador for Celsius. “I wore ankle weights, sipped my Celsius drink, and walked around the arena. Every night, I made it a habit to walk up to the highest seat and watch the trucks load the stage.”

When she’s not on tour, Kelsea focuses on Pilates and listens carefully to her body. “Right now, I follow the 80/20 rule,” she explained. “Eighty percent of the time, I am mindful about my health. That means not just eating well and exercising but also taking care of my mental health, my life, and my relationships. The other 20 percent is about having fun.”

This summer, Kelsea plans to try something new: tennis. “I’ve never played before,” she said. “I just ordered a racket and I’m excited to give it a shot.”

Other Stars Share Their Favorite Workouts

Kaley Cuoco

Eight months after giving birth to her daughter Matilda, Kaley enjoys treadmill workouts as part of her postpartum fitness. She told Today.com, “Increasing the incline is great for muscles and circulation. Sometimes, I walk backward too, which really works the legs and glutes.”

Becky G

After a life-changing 2023, Becky credits fitness for her well-being. “The healthiest version of me benefits most from working out,” she said. “If you stick to it, you’ll live longer with this habit than without it.” Her favorite workouts include stretching, home exercises, and walks outdoors.

Kelly Clarkson

Moving to New York City inspired Kelly’s health journey. She told People, “Walking in the city is a great workout. I also love infrared saunas and recently started cold plunges because friends convinced me.”

Julianne Hough

With a busy schedule, Julianne makes time for exercise. “I walk the hills with my dog. That’s important because she needs it too,” she told E! News. “Even short movement sessions matter. When I have more time, I enjoy Kinrgy classes, Pilates, or yoga. I like mixing different workouts.”
